Re: [Mod] Simple Shooter [0.5.3] [shooter]
You only need to have the ammo pack somewhere in your inventory, the gun will reload automatically if fired once fully spent, the ammo will then be deducted from the inventory (unless you are using creative mode)Alienant1 wrote:sorry if it is really obvious, how do you use an ammo pack? do you just put it in the crafting grid with the gun? does the gun have to be empty?

Re: [Mod] Simple Shooter [0.5.3] [shooter]
Are you in multiplayer? TNT is disabled by default in multiplayer.
